Transaction 1d978667f25de5185ce8e34eebfdcce9ccc29069711812ad455fa3714346faea
1 Input
2 Outputs
- 1d978667f25de5185ce8e34eebfdcce9ccc29069711812ad455fa3714346faea:0
- 1d978667f25de5185ce8e34eebfdcce9ccc29069711812ad455fa3714346faea:1
value 2561353
address 38wzcf5S9baE5VMfRx93mXjTG1Dw1uci1U
value 7100545
address 13aP1gzguMLdbZtt8Rpe5vsK21v7MmDfdd